Gisa, resucitadora gloriosa
Criatura legendaria — Hechicero humano
4 / 4
Si una criatura que controla un oponente fuera a morir, en vez de eso, exíliala.
Al comienzo de tu mantenimiento, pon en el campo de batalla bajo tu control todas las cartas de criatura exiliadas con Gisa, resucitadora gloriosa. Ganan la habilidad de descomposición. (Una criatura con la habilidad de descomposición no puede bloquear. Cuando ataque, sacrifícala al final del combate.)
Once a creature with decayed attacks, it will be sacrificed at end of combat, even if it no longer has decayed at that time.
Because creatures controlled by opponents aren't dying due to Gisa's replacement effect, any "when [this creature] dies" triggered abilities those creatures have won't trigger.
Decayed represents a static ability and a triggered ability. "Decayed" means "This creature can't block" and "When this creature attacks, sacrifice it at end of combat."
Decayed does not create any attacking requirements. You may choose not to attack with a creature that has decayed.
Gisa does not grant haste to the creatures that are returned to the battlefield, so you normally won't be able to attack with them the turn they are returned.
Decayed does not grant haste. Creatures with decayed that enter the battlefield during your turn may not attack until your next turn.
If a creature your opponent controls would die and more than one effect would cause it to be exiled, that opponent chooses which one to apply. If the creature is exiled due to some other replacement effect, it will not be returned to the battlefield with Gisa.
